



Metalicity is focussed on delivering value to shareholders through the development of high-quality minerals tenements in Western Australia, specifically copper-focused projects.
The Company is currently executing a strategy of identifying, exploring and acquiring assets as it completes a period of value realisation from its existing project portfolio.
Recently, Metalicity has secured exploration licence applications in the Paterson Province of northwest Western Australia, which is rapidly growing into one of the nation’s most prolific and underexplored copper belts. The Company is also actively assessing more advanced project opportunities in the copper and base metals area.
Concurrently, Metalicity is progressing an IPO of its zinc assets on Canada’s TSX-V which will see the Company well capitalised while also maintaining one of the largest exposures to undeveloped zinc deposits through its remaining interest.
Exploration licence's (ELA's) under application in the Paterson district, WA.
ELA’s highly prospective for copper and based metals, covering a large area of 1,266km².
The Projects are located within the interpreted El Paso corridor that comprises Rio Tinto’s Winu, Antipa Resource Minyari and Greatland Gold Haverion copper gold deposits..
